Typical Roofing Problems
While roofs are built to resist different environmental conditions, they regularly develop problems that call for professional repairs. Typical problems include leaks, which can arise from damaged shingles or flashing, resulting in water infiltration and potential structural damage. Wind and hail can cause considerable physical damage, removing tiles or creating dents that threaten the roof's integrity. Additionally, the accumulation of debris can create water pooling, promoting mold growth and further deterioration. Improper ventilation may cause overheating in attic spaces, resulting in premature wear on roofing materials. Homeowners should also be alert about signs of aging roofs, such as curling or missing shingles. Recognizing these problems early is vital for preserving the roof's longevity and safeguarding the home's overall structure.
Repair Methods Explained
Grasping the various repair techniques is essential for homeowners experiencing roof concerns. Professional roofing professionals utilize several techniques to address particular problems effectively. One common method is patching, which involves applying a durable material over damaged areas to stop leaks. Another technique is roof flashing repair, where metal strips are secured around chimneys and vents to seal gaps. For more significant damage, professionals may suggest re-roofing, which requires layering new shingles over existing ones. Additionally, expert roofers often employ sealants to waterproof exposed areas. Each approach is customized to the specific type of roof and the extent of the damage, guaranteeing that the repairs are both effective and long-lasting. Varieties of Roofing Materials
Choosing the right roofing material is essential for any full roof installation, as it directly affects the structure's resilience, aesthetics, and energy efficiency. Various materials are available, each offering distinct benefits. Asphalt shingles are favored due to their affordability and versatility, while metal roofing is prized for its longevity and resistance to extreme weather. Clay and concrete tiles deliver exceptional longevity and a distinctive appearance, making them perfect for certain architectural styles. Additionally, wood shakes offer a natural look but require more maintenance. Synthetic alternatives, such as rubber and polymer, mimic traditional materials while offering enhanced longevity and lower weight. Finally, the choice of roofing material should align with the homeowner's budget, aesthetic preferences, and local climate conditions.
Setup Process Overview
A new roof installation encompasses various vital stages that provide a long-lasting and solid framework. Initially, professional roofing experts assess the existing roof and determine the necessary repairs or replacements. Subsequently, they set up the location by extracting previous materials and maintaining an organized working area. Then, underlayment installation takes place, creating a waterproof shield against water damage. When this foundation is established, the preferred roofing material is meticulously arranged, confirming accurate alignment and tight securing. Flashing is then installed around chimneys and vents to prevent leaks. In conclusion, a detailed review is carried out to verify all parts satisfy industry requirements. This meticulous approach guarantees long-lasting protection against the elements.

How Long Does the Average Roof Last?
The typical duration a roof lasts depends on its material composition; asphalt shingle roofing typically lasts 15-30 years, metal roofs typically survive 40-70 years, while tile and slate roofing frequently surpasses 50 years, based on upkeep and climate conditions.
How Often Should I Schedule Roof Inspections?
Property owners should schedule roof inspections no less than two times per year, optimally in the spring and fall seasons. In addition, inspections are suggested after severe weather events to detect prospective damage and guarantee the roof's longevity and integrity.
